O slideshow foi denunciado.
Utilizamos seu perfil e dados de atividades no LinkedIn para personalizar e exibir anúncios mais relevantes. Altere suas preferências de anúncios quando desejar.

Casual Game for Windows Mobile

10.976 visualizações

Publicada em

Casual Game for Windows Mobile

Publicada em: Tecnologia
  • Seja o primeiro a comentar

Casual Game for Windows Mobile

  1. WiMoGF를 이용한윈도우 폰 캐주얼 게임 개발<br />지승욱 (tomatowax@naver.com)<br />㈜마인드폴 대표이사<br />www.mindpol.com<br />홈페이지 : www.tomatowax.com<br />트위터: @tomatowax<br />
  2. Agenda<br />MindPol Corporation<br />Windows Mobile Games<br />Windows Phone Specifications<br />Development Environment<br />WiMo Game Frameworks<br />Yabog Game<br />AppleTree Game<br />Galatea Engine<br />
  3. MindPol Corporation<br />Games / Technology / Characters / Animation<br />Portable Device Game Engine & Contents<br />Windows Mobile / Android / iPhone<br />Future Device Graphics Research<br />
  4. Windows Mobile Games<br />Hexic<br />Tiki Towers<br />
  5. Windows Mobile Games<br />Call of Duty 2<br />Xtrakt<br />
  6. Windows Mobile Games<br />국내 T Store<br />탱크 에이스 1944<br />초코초코타이쿤<br />
  7. Windows Mobile Games<br />MindPol Games – 10 Games for Betting<br />
  8. Windows Phone Specifications<br />This is the future.<br />
  9. Windows Phone Specifications<br />Windows Mobile OS 6.x (6.1, 6.5, …)<br />최신 기기들은 1GHz CPU 이상 탑재<br />3D GPU 가속 기능 탑재<br />Direct 3D Mobile (D3DM)<br />OpenGL|ES 1.0, 1.1, 1.x, 2.0 지원<br /> - Vertex/Pixel Shader<br />멀티태스킹 지원<br />WiFi & Bluetooth<br />
  10. Development Environment<br />Hardware :<br />- Windows PC<br />- Smartphone Device (없어도 개발 가능)<br />Software :<br /> - Visual Studio 2008 Professional<br /> - Windows Mobile SDK 6 Refresh<br />It’s very simple!<br />
  11. Development Environment<br />쉽고 간편한 윈도폰 개발 환경<br />익숙하고 어렵지 않은 개발 환경<br />무겁지 않은 Visual Studio<br />빠르고 쉬운 개발 디버깅<br />안전한 에뮬레이터 제공<br />강력한 ActiveSync 와파일탐색기<br />C/C++ 언어와 C# 언어 동시 지원<br />다양한 개발 라이브러리 및 프레임워크<br />.NetFramework 제공<br />
  12. WiMo Game Frameworks<br />C# 언어 사용<br />.Net Framework 기반<br />XNA Framework 사용<br />Windows Mobile / Silver Light / Zune HD 지원<br />쉽고 빠르게 어플리케이션 개발<br />다양한 플랫폼 동시 지원<br />다양한 매니저 객체 제공<br />http://wimogf.codeplex.com/<br />
  13. WiMo Game Frameworks<br />
  14. 게임 프레임워크 구성<br />실제 게임 코드 작성<br />WiMo Game Frameworks<br />IGame객체 정의<br />플랫폼 지정 및 해상도 지정<br />Program.cs<br />Game.cs<br />
  15. WiMo Game Frameworks<br />Program.cs<br />IGameEngine객체 생성<br />각종 Manager 객체 대입 및 멤버 변수 설정<br />- Display<br />- MenuManager<br />- InputManager<br />- PhysicsManager<br /><ul><li>CollisionManager</li></ul>- …<br />IGameEngine으로 IGame생성<br />Application.Run(IGameEngine.Form)<br />
  16. WiMo Game Frameworks<br />Game.cs (IGame)<br />Initialize()<br />BeginRun()<br />CreateMenus()<br />LoadContent()<br />Update( GameTimegameTime )<br />Draw( GameTimegameTime )<br />CanExit()<br />16<br />
  17. Yabog Game<br />WiMoGF게임 - WiMoGF샘플<br />
  18. AppleTree Game<br />WiMoGF게임 – 지승욱(TomatoWAX)제작<br />
  19. Galatea Engine<br />
  20. Galatea Engine<br />휴대용 장치 3D 게임 엔진<br />타겟 플랫폼에 최적화된 프레임워크<br />Windows Mobile / Android / …<br />DirectX 와 OpenGL API 지원<br />모든 플랫폼 왼손 좌표계 사용<br />리소스 편집 통합 툴킷 제공<br />
  21. Galatea Engine<br />Galatea Engine<br />Library<br />Toolkit<br />Documents<br />Samples<br />Demos<br />Movies<br />…<br />
  22. Galatea Engine<br />Library<br />- Math<br /><ul><li> Sprite
  23. Texture
  24. Material
  25. Mesh
  26. Skeleton
  27. Frame
  28. Model
  29. Resource System
  30. …</li></ul>Editor<br /><ul><li> Texture
  31. Material
  32. Mesh
  33. Skeleton
  34. Frame
  35. Particle
  36. …</li></li></ul><li>Galatea Engine<br />
  37. Galatea Engine<br />www.GalateaTechnology.com<br />www.GameDevNut.net<br />
  38. 마무리<br />윈도우 폰은 굉장히 개발자에게 친숙한 디바이스<br />모든 장르와 스타일의 게임 개발 가능<br />WiFi를 통한 강력한 네트워킹 기능 제공<br />이제 모바일 게임은 기존의 모바일 게임이 아니다.<br />일반 PC 게임 수준과 대등한 게임들을 네트워킹이 가능한 휴대용 장치에서 즐길 수 있는 모바일 시대<br />강력한 기능과 무한한 환경을 제공하는 윈도우 모바일 플랫폼에서 멋진 모바일 게임 개발을!<br />

×